    Further correspondence regarding the sale of the Manse, 1980 Together with photocopy of deed: Conveyance i) John Abraham, Turvey, lacemerchant ii) Nathaniel Godfrey, surgeon George Paine, grocer John Paine, jnr, farmer Joseph Parris, baker John Pearson, farmer Thomas Bailey, farmer James Chater, innkeeper Samuel Vincent, grocer, William Pinkard, plumber Joseph Finche, butcher Thomas Sandy, carpenter James Wooding, carpenter John Sanders, sawyer John Bamford, gamekeeper Charles Wallenger, labourer, all of Turvey. George Parris, Lavendon, Bucks, farmer William Kilpin, Bedford, ironmonger William Whitmee, Stoke Goldington, Bucks, farmer iii) The Rev Josiah Bull, Newport P gnell, Protestant Dissenting Minister Reciting lease and release of 3 and 4 December 1828 and enrolled in Chancery [see X729/6/6] Reciting that a Meeting House was erected in pursuance of the trusts now in consideration of £19 paid to i) by ii) and 10s paid to i) by iii) i) releases to iii) - piece of land in Turvey N to S 30 yards (length) E to W 10 yards (breadth) Bounded W other property of i) and to be divided from said property by stone wall to be erected and maintained by ii) S end other property of i) E Thomas Charles Higgins, Esq, (in occupation of Thomas Covington) N end said Meeting House To be held by iii) to use of ii) on trust to permit the erection of a dwelling house, to be built at the expense of the members of the Society of Protestant Dissenters, and to let said house from year to year at best rent which can be obtained. Money raised to be used to pay insurance premium (amount to be insured - £200) and then cost of repair and maintenance. Surplus to be used as decided by meeting of men members and subscribers. Surplus rents to be used for the promotion of Pedo Baptist denomination at Turvey. Power to mortgage, sell and exchange property. If worship ceases for 14 years then property to be disposed of to such religious or charitable causes as 2/3rds of trustees and principal subscribers shall decide. Power to appoint new trustees (to total of 18) sigs all Endorsed receipt Wits W B Bull, sol., Newport Pagnell Thomas Glidewell, clerk to Mr Bull
